don provan wrote:
As a learner, I think you're focused on the movement commands so much that you are forgetting that they are only four of hundreds of commands that are bound to various key sequences on multiple layers under your finger tips. As you learn the other key sequences, you'll find that the mnemonic help in remembering the less used commands and the vertical relation between control and meta is much more important than any initial desire to cluster the four movement keys in some central location.
Those are excellent points. In fact, the 4 basic movement commands usually become less used as one learns that there are more efficient ways to navigate, and even more efficient ways to edit that require less navigation. -- Kevin
